Route will be shut for 10 days
The Mountain Road will close later this morning for maintenance work, including preparing the route for this year's TT.
The Department of Infrastructure says the route will shut from Creg ny Baa to Bungalow as well as Bungalow to Ramsey, with the road between Bungalow Bridge and the Victory Cafe remaining open.
It's to allow for road race preparation work, gully and verge cutting, surface patch repairs, work to damaged walls and felling of dead or dying roadside trees.
The closure comes into force at 9.30am with work expected to be completed by 3.30pm on Friday 17 April.
Access to the Victory Cafe, Snaefell Summit Cafe, Snaefell Mountain Road and Creg ny Baa will be maintained at all times.
